Accsee數據查詢系統是一種基于ASP技術的數據查詢系統,它可以通過編寫簡單的ASP代碼來實現對底層數據庫的查詢和操作。在數據處理和分析領域,ASP被廣泛應用于開發各種基于Web的應用程序,它具有簡單易學、高效快速的特點。Accsee數據查詢系統利用ASP的優勢,提供了一種高效、簡便的方式來查詢和操作數據,為用戶提供了極大的便利性。
Accsee數據查詢系統具有許多優點。首先,它可以輕松地與各種數據庫系統進行集成,并對其進行查詢和操作。例如,我們可以使用ASP代碼連接到SQL Server數據庫,并執行查詢以檢索數據。具體示例如下:
<% '建立數據庫連接
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.ConnectionString = "DRIVER={SQL Server};SERVER=127.0.0.1;DATABASE=TestDB;UID=sa;PWD=123456"
conn.Open
'執行SQL查詢
Dim strSQL
strSQL = "SELECT * FROM Students"
Dim rs
Set rs = conn.Execute(strSQL)
'輸出查詢結果
While Not rs.EOF
Response.Write rs("Name") & " " & rs("Age") & "<br>"
rs.MoveNext
Wend
'關閉數據庫連接
rs.Close
conn.Close
%>
上述代碼實例中,我們首先建立與SQL Server數據庫的連接,并使用一條SQL語句查詢了Students表中的數據,然后將查詢結果逐行輸出到頁面上。這種簡單直接的方式使得用戶可以輕松地實現對數據庫的查詢和操作。
其次,Accsee數據查詢系統還支持參數化查詢,可以根據用戶輸入的條件來查詢數據,從而提高查詢的準確性和靈活性。例如,我們可以在ASP代碼中使用參數化查詢實現根據用戶輸入的學生姓名,查詢該學生的成績信息。具體示例如下:
<% '建立數據庫連接
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.ConnectionString = "DRIVER={SQL Server};SERVER=127.0.0.1;DATABASE=TestDB;UID=sa;PWD=123456"
conn.Open
'獲取用戶輸入的學生姓名
dim studentName
studentName = Request.QueryString("name")
'執行參數化查詢
Dim strSQL
strSQL = "SELECT * FROM Students WHERE Name=?"
Dim rs
Set cmd = Server.CreateObject("ADODB.Command")
cmd.ActiveConnection = conn
cmd.CommandText = strSQL
cmd.Parameters.Append(cmd.CreateParameter("name", adVarChar, adParamInput, 50, studentName))
Set rs = cmd.Execute
'輸出查詢結果
While Not rs.EOF
Response.Write rs("Name") & " " & rs("Score") & "<br>"
rs.MoveNext
Wend
'關閉數據庫連接
rs.Close
conn.Close
%>
上述代碼實例中,我們首先獲取了用戶輸入的學生姓名,并使用參數化查詢的方式查詢了該學生的成績信息。通過參數化查詢,用戶可以根據自己的需要靈活地查詢數據,提高了查詢準確性和查詢效率。
綜上所述,Accsee數據查詢系統是一種基于ASP技術的高效、簡便的數據查詢系統。它可以輕松地與各種數據庫系統進行集成,并支持簡單直接的查詢方式和參數化查詢方式。這使得用戶可以極為靈活地對數據進行查詢和操作,為數據處理和分析提供了強大的支持。